Matrix-Assisted Laser Desorption Ionization (MALDI) and Atmospheric Pressure-MALDI (AP-MALDI)

2020
Matrix-assisted laser desorption/ionization (MALDI) mass spectrometry is one of the most widely used soft ionization methods for biomolecules. Atmospheric pressure-MALDI was introduced, increasing the ease of sample preparation and allowing for the analysis of volatile molecules, as the sample no longer needs to be placed under vacuum prior to analysis.

A MALDI Probe for Mass Spectrometers

Analytical Chemistry, 1997
A new MALDI probe has been designed that uses transmission geometry. This geometry allows the probe to be fashioned after typical EI/CI solid probes which enables it to be introduced into spatially constrained ion source regions such as encountered in quadrupole ion trap mass spectrometers.
